Bullion came off earlier lows and moved into positive territory on Friday after investors felt the
commodity had fallen too far amid a dollar rally. Gold prices have tumbled in recent months as
markets prep for the Fed to raise interest rates, which is widely seen taking place in 2015, as higher
borrowing costs chip away at the precious metal's appeal as a hedge to weaker paper currencies, the
product of loose monetary policy. The dollar continued to see support after the U.S. Department of
Labor said on Thursday that the number of individuals filing for initial jobless benefits in the week
ending Dec. 12 fell by 6,000 to 289,000 from the previous week’s revised total of 295,000. Economist
had forecast an increase of 1,000. The data came a day after the Fed said it would be "patient" before
raising rates, guidance which it said is consistent with earlier assurances statement that rates would
stay low "for a considerable time." Fed Chair Janet Yellen said the central bank was unlikely to raise
rates for the "next couple of meetings" indicating that a move in April at the earliest is possible. Still,
the dollar firmed on the notion that the days of rock-bottom interest rates are coming to an end,
which chipped away at gold prices until bottom fishers sent the commodity back into positive
